Keefe, Fire Chief The attached set of building plans have been reviewed by The Fire Prevention Bureau and are acceptable with the following concerns: 1. The total number of fire extinguishers required for your establishment is calculated at one extinguisher for each 3000 sq. ft. of area. The extinguisher(s) should be of the "All Purpose" (2A, 10B:C) dry chemical type. Travel distance to any fire extinguisher must be 75' or less. (NFPA 10, 3 -1.1) Portable fire extinguishers shall be securely installed on the hanger or in the bracket supplied, placed in cabinets or wall recesses. The hanger or bracket shall be securely and properly anchored to the mounting surface in accordance with the manufacturer's instructions. The extinguisher shall be installed so that the top of the extinguisher is not more than 5 feet above the floor and the clearance between the bottom of the extinguisher and the floor shall not be less than 4 inches. Extinguishers shall be located so as to be in plain view (if at all possible), or if not in plain view, they shall be identified with a sign stating, "Fire Extinguisher ", with an arrow pointing to the unit. (NFPA 10, 1 -6.3) (UFC Standard 10 -1) Clear access to fire extinguishers is required at all times. They may not be hidden or obstructed. (NFPA 10, 1 -6.5) John W. Each wire shall be attached to the ceiling member and to the support above with a minimum of three turns Wires shall not be more than Ito 6 out of plumb unless countersloping wires are provided Wires shall not attach to or bend around interfering objects or equipment. PERIMETER HANGERS: The terminal ends of each cross runner and main runner shall be supported independently a maximum of 8" from each wall or ceiling discontinuity of other approved all support. LATERAL FORCE BRACING: Where substantiation design calculations are not provided, horizontal restraints shall be effected by four #12 gage wires secured to the runner main within two inches of the intersection of the cross runner and splayed 90 degrees from each other at an angle not exceeding 45 degrees from the plane of the ceiling. These horizontal restraints shall be placed not more than 12' oc in both directions and with the first point within 6' from each wall. Attachments of the restraint wires shall be adequate to resist the loads imposed. UGHTING FIXTURES: Only "intermediate and heavy duty" grid as defined by Section 47.1802 shall be used to support of lighting fixtures. All lighting fixtures shall be positively attached to the grid system. When intermediate systems are used, #12 gage hangers shall be attached to the grid within 3 of each corner of each fixture. Supplemental hangers are not required with a heavy duty system if a 48" modular hanger pattern is followed. Lighting fixtures weighing less than 56# shall have in addition to the requirements above, two #12 gage hangers connected from the fixture housing to the structure above. These wires may be slack. Pendent -hung lighting fixtures shall be supported directly from the structure above with #9 gage wire or approved alternate. MECHANICAL SERVICES: Ceiling mounted air - terminal or services weighing less than 20# shall be positively attached to the main runners or cross runners with the same carrying capacity as the main runner. PARTITIONS: Where the suspended ceiling system Is required to provide lateral support for permanent or relocatable partition, all components of the system shall be designed to support the reaction force of the partition from prescribed loads perpendicular to the Mace of the partition. These loads shall be in addition to the loads described in Section 25.211. Engineering shall be required to suit individual partition applications and be shown on the approved drawings.
